[求助]关于虚函数程序问题
求助]请高人大哥大姐们来指点下关于虚函数的问题
希望各位大哥大姐能帮帮我,.刚学这个问题如下:
如何用C++遍一个程序
在输入类型和高度之后
打印出相映的用" * "号组成的三角形
*
**
***
****
*****类型1
*
***
*****
*******
*********
类型2
*
**
***
****
*****类型3
*****
****
***
**
*
类型4
*********
*******
*****
***
* 类型5
*****
****
***
**
*类型6
例如输如:1,7
则屏幕打印出
*
**
***
****
*****
******
*******
我编的程序如下:
class triangle{
int height;
int get height();
void set height(int height);
void draw();
};
triangle{int base;
public:
triangle_1 (int b)
{base=b;}
int i,j,h,k;
i=j=base-1
for(h=height-1;h--)
}
for(k=i;k;k--)
stream<<'*';
stream<<'*';
}
i--;
stream<<endl;
}
for(k=0;k<base;k++)
stream<<'*';
stream<<endl;
return stream;
}
main()
{triangle (5,5);
viod draw();
return 0;
}
大家帮我改改吧
如何用C++遍一个程序
在输入类型和高度之后
打印出相映的用" * "号组成的三角形
*
**
***
****
*****类型1
*
***
*****
*******
*********
类型2
*
**
***
****
*****类型3
*****
****
***
**
*
类型4
*********
*******
*****
***
* 类型5
*****
****
***
**
*类型6
例如输如:1,7
则屏幕打印出
*
**
***
****
*****
******
*******
我编的程序如下:
class triangle{
int height;
int get height();
void set height(int height);
void draw();
};
triangle{int base;
public:
triangle_1 (int b)
{base=b;}
int i,j,h,k;
i=j=base-1
for(h=height-1;h--)
}
for(k=i;k;k--)
stream<<'*';
stream<<'*';
}
i--;
stream<<endl;
}
for(k=0;k<base;k++)
stream<<'*';
stream<<endl;
return stream;
}
main()
{triangle (5,5);
viod draw();
return 0;
}
大家帮我改改吧
[此贴子已经被作者于2006-5-29 20:37:49编辑过]